It says open as of 9:30, but the first tour starts at 10 am and it is allowed to enter with a tour guide only (included in the price of the ticket). Great place and it exceeded our expectations. We came there 20 minutes early. During the week and in October there were 2 tours starting at exact hour with a guide. Exact times were posted on Facebook. Guide Darek was realy great, shared lot of interesting insights about as he worked there for 20 years. He talked about foundation of the as well as some funny stories. Special think for us was chance to walk freely among like deers, raindeers, does, elks. The top part was display of wolf's - 12 of them in their area, feeding on meat. Best with we have seen so far. Calm place to visit with family. Possible to come close to the - supervised by well experienced and knowledgeable guide. Lot's of wild here, saved from death, unable to survive in the nature.
